Rupi Kaur (Punjabi: ਰੂਪੀ ਕੌਰ) is a Canadian poet, writer, and illustrator. She is popular for her unique use of poetry with illustration, all of which she does herself. Rupi works to transform experiences of pain and longing into anthems of acceptance and triumph. She published a book of poetry and prose entitled milk and honey in 2015. The book deals with themes of violence, abuse, love, loss, and femininity and has been met with wild success, selling over a million copies and becoming #1 on the New York Times bestseller list. 2Life Rupi Kaur was born in Punjab, India to a Sikh family and emigrated with her parents to Toronto, Canada when she was 4. As a child, she was inspired by her mother to draw and paint, especially at a time when she was unable to speak in English with the other children at school. She used to write poems to her friends on their birthdays or messages to her middle school crushes. Growing up, she yearned for access to words written by people who looked like her, writing about things that she was going through.
